**Job Summary**:
**CBORD Specialist** is responsible for the day-to-day operational delivery of the business processes provided by the CBORD food service information system including menu planning, nutritional analysis, implementation, monitoring and evaluation of the CBORD system. The **CBORD Specialist** role is required to develop and maintain appropriate databases supporting all CBORD modules. Reviews, recommends, trains staff and performs changes required to the system to meet the day-to-day business requirements and future business needs.

**Clinical component**:

- Reviews & maintains nutritional information of all food products; seeks and recommends new products to maintain or enhance nutritional quality.
- Leads menu development (e.g., new menus, seasonal menus, etc.) and ensures nutritional analysis of all diets is completed accurately and nutritional information is maintained.

**CBORD Management component**:

- Leads the development, implementation, maintenance, and integration of the CBORD food service information system and acts as an expert resource. Analyzes and maintains database supporting system solutions by establishing quality checks and verification points for all accuracy of data.
- Designs and implements training for all end users on the CBORD modules and reports and develops appropriate end user training documentation.
- Communicates and documents all system failures, unusual delays, financial impacts, and impacts to patient care.
- Works in collaboration with Compass Group Canada’s IT, client’s IT and CBORD to provide system and database functionality support to end users.

**Administrative**:

- Manages the Diet Office’s staffing, processes and meal delivery systems related to CBORD to ensure efficiency.
- Maintains adequate inventory on site ensuring appropriate ordering processes are set in place.
- Develops implements and maintains system backups and emergency recovery procedures for the department.
- Ensures audit completion for the department based on KPIs.
- Oversee the daily food service in assigned areas including supervising designated staff, maintaining, and updating manual and computerized records
- Performs other duties as required.

**Qualifications**:

- Graduation from an approved post-secondary nutrition program.
- Active member of the Canadian Society of Nutrition Management (CSNM) minimum requirement.
- Experience with CBORD food and nutrition system or any other diet software.
- Demonstrated ability to develop and analyze menus for an acute clinical and residential settings.
- Excellent organizational, project management and time management skills.
- Excellent attention to detail analytical and communication skills, both verbal and written.
- Ability to successfully communicate solutions to technical, operational, and clinical issues.
- User-level technical problem-solving skills.
- Demonstrated ability to establish effective working relationships with technical, operational, clinical, vendor and client staff.
- Strong customer service orientation.
- Ability to work with end-users of varying skill levels at all levels of the organization.
- Ability to utilize resources effectively.
- Creative, positive, solution-oriented attitude in the workplace.
- Demonstrated knowledge of Microsoft Excel and Microsoft Word.
